Payment and Costs

Depositing with credit cards in casino games can sometimes involve fees, either from the casino or the card issuer. Although many casinos absorb these charges, some pass them on to players, ranging from small fixed fees to percentage-based commissions.

Interest charges can also accumulate if deposits are treated as cash advances by the credit card company, which often carry higher interest rates and no grace period.

Players should review their cardholder agreements and casino fee disclosures to avoid unexpected costs. Additionally, currency conversion fees may apply if the casino operates in a different currency from the credit card account.
